intend

gb/ɪntˈɛnd/ us/ɪntˈɛnd/
B1 อังกฤษ
~ 1000
tervez, szándékozik, ért valamit valami alatt, akar mondani valamit valamivel, szán, készül
คำกริยา B1
1
รูปแบบการใช้:
to intend to [do something]
I intend to finish this project by Friday.
Úgy tervezem, hogy péntekig befejezem ezt a projektet.
She intends to move abroad next year.
Azt tervezi, hogy jövőre külföldre költözik.
We fully intend to keep our promise.
They intend for their children to attend college.
I never intended to hurt your feelings.
ตัวอย่างสำหรับผู้เรียน
I intend to call you tomorrow.
Úgy tervezem, hogy holnap felhívlak.
He intends to buy a car.
Autót tervez venni.
We intend to visit Paris.
She intends to learn English.
They intend to play soccer.
ข้อผิดพลาดที่พบบ่อย:
Learners sometimes confuse 'intend' with 'attend'. 'Intend' means to plan or aim, while 'attend' means to be present at an event.
ความหมาย
Plan or aim to do something
คำที่ใช้ร่วมกัน
intend to go |intend to use |intend to start |fully intend |intend for someone
คำพ้องความหมาย
plan (More general; can refer to making arrangements, not just having an aim.) | aim (Focuses more on the goal rather than the act of planning.)
คำตรงข้าม
neglect (Implies not planning or failing to consider doing something.) | forget (Implies losing the idea or plan from memory.)
หัวข้อ
daily life |planning |communication |core_vocabulary |daily_life
คำจำกัดความ

To plan or want to do something.

To have a plan, purpose, or aim in mind for doing something in the future.

คำกริยา B2
2
รูปแบบการใช้:
to intend [something] by [words/action]
What do you intend by that remark?
Mit akarsz ezzel a megjegyzéssel mondani?
I intended my comment as a joke.
Tréfának szántam a megjegyzésemet.
He intended the gift as a peace offering.
ตัวอย่างสำหรับผู้เรียน
I intended my words as thanks.
Köszönetnek szántam a szavaimat.
She intended the smile as a welcome.
A mosolyát üdvözlésnek szánta.
He intended the note as a warning.
ข้อผิดพลาดที่พบบ่อย:
Learners may confuse this with simply 'meaning' something without considering intention; 'intend' stresses deliberate choice.
ความหมาย
Mean something by words or actions
คำที่ใช้ร่วมกัน
intend a message |intend meaning |intend as a compliment
คำพ้องความหมาย
mean (Most common equivalent; 'intend' can sound slightly more formal or deliberate.)
คำตรงข้าม
misinterpret (Implies understanding differently from what was meant.)
หัวข้อ
communication |interpretation |core_vocabulary
คำจำกัดความ

To mean something when you say or do it.

To have a particular meaning or implication in mind when saying or doing something.

คำกริยา B1
3
รูปแบบการใช้:
to intend [something] for [someone/something]
This book is intended for beginners.
Ez a könyv kezdőknek készült.
The funds are intended for community projects.
A pénzt közösségi projektekre szánják.
The medicine is intended to treat high blood pressure.
ตัวอย่างสำหรับผู้เรียน
This toy is intended for small children.
Ez a játék kisgyerekeknek készült.
The food is intended for the party.
Az étel a bulira készült.
This chair is intended for the office.
ความหมาย
Design for a particular use/person
คำที่ใช้ร่วมกัน
intended for children |intended audience |intended use
คำพ้องความหมาย
designate (More formal; often used in official contexts.) | allocate (Focuses on assigning resources rather than purpose.)
คำตรงข้าม
misuse (Using something for a purpose it was not planned for.)
หัวข้อ
design |planning |core_vocabulary |work
คำจำกัดความ

To make or choose something for a person or purpose.

To make, design, or plan something so that it is used by a particular person or for a specific purpose.
